browsertrix/backend/btrixcloud
Ilya Kreymer d4a2a66d6d
additional scale / browser window cleanup to properly support QA: (#2663)
- follow up to #2627 
- use qa_num_browser_windows to set exact number of QA browsers,
fallback to qa_scale
- set num_browser_windows and num_browsers_per_pod using crawler / qa
values depending if QA crawl
- scale_from_browser_windows() accepts optional browsers_per_pod if
dealing with possible QA override
- store 'desiredScale' in CrawlStatus to avoid recomputing for later
scale resolving
- ensure status.scale is always the actual scale observed
2025-06-12 13:09:04 -04:00
..
migrations Allow users to run crawls with 1 or 2 browser windows (#2627) 2025-06-03 13:37:30 -07:00
operator additional scale / browser window cleanup to properly support QA: (#2663) 2025-06-12 13:09:04 -04:00
__init__.py
auth.py
background_jobs.py
basecrawls.py Pause / Resume Crawls Initial Implmentation. (#2572) 2025-05-21 14:05:16 -07:00
colls.py remove deleted collections from crawlconfigs (#2615) 2025-05-20 18:38:40 -07:00
crawlconfigs.py Optimize single-page crawl workflows (#2656) 2025-06-10 12:13:57 -07:00
crawlmanager.py Optimize single-page crawl workflows (#2656) 2025-06-10 12:13:57 -07:00
crawls.py Allow users to run crawls with 1 or 2 browser windows (#2627) 2025-06-03 13:37:30 -07:00
db.py Allow users to run crawls with 1 or 2 browser windows (#2627) 2025-06-03 13:37:30 -07:00
emailsender.py
invites.py
k8sapi.py Optimize single-page crawl workflows (#2656) 2025-06-10 12:13:57 -07:00
main_bg.py
main_migrations.py
main_op.py
main.py Allow users to run crawls with 1 or 2 browser windows (#2627) 2025-06-03 13:37:30 -07:00
models.py Allow users to run crawls with 1 or 2 browser windows (#2627) 2025-06-03 13:37:30 -07:00
ops.py
orgs.py Allow users to run crawls with 1 or 2 browser windows (#2627) 2025-06-03 13:37:30 -07:00
pages.py Add Org Check for Collection access (#2616) 2025-05-20 15:30:22 -07:00
pagination.py
profiles.py support overriding crawler image pull policy per channel (#2523) 2025-03-31 14:11:41 -07:00
storages.py Optimize presigning for replay.json (#2516) 2025-05-20 12:09:35 -07:00
subs.py Add API endpoint to check if subscription is activated (#2582) 2025-05-06 17:36:58 -07:00
uploads.py Add Org Check for Collection access (#2616) 2025-05-20 15:30:22 -07:00
users.py Fix user emails use userout (#2511) 2025-03-24 12:04:39 -07:00
utils.py additional scale / browser window cleanup to properly support QA: (#2663) 2025-06-12 13:09:04 -04:00
version.py version: bump to 1.17.0-beta.0 2025-06-02 14:46:32 -07:00
webhooks.py